Presco flagging tape is a non-adhesive vinyl marking tape used to identify locations, hazards, or boundaries on job sites. It is lightweight, flexible, and easy to apply, making it a staple tool for professionals who need quick and visible markings.
Presco has built a strong reputation as a manufacturer of marking and safety products. Known for consistent quality and adherence to industry standards, Presco supplies materials used daily by utility crews, contractors, and surveyors.
Their flagging tape products are manufactured with durability in mind, ensuring performance in outdoor environments where exposure to wind, moisture, and sunlight is unavoidable.
Flagging tape serves as a visual communication tool. It helps crews quickly recognize important information without the need for signage or written instructions. Common uses include:
Identifying underground utilities
Marking hazards or restricted areas
Outlining project boundaries
Designating survey reference points
Highlighting temporary changes on site
When markings remain clear and visible, crews can move efficiently while maintaining safety standards.

Presco flagging tape is typically made from durable vinyl that resists tearing and stretching. This construction allows the tape to hold up when tied to stakes, fences, or vegetation without snapping under tension.
The vinyl material also ensures flexibility, making the tape easy to handle even in cold or wet conditions.
Visibility is one of the most important features of any flagging tape. Presco offers a wide range of bright and fluorescent colors that stand out against soil, grass, pavement, and debris.
These colors support standardized utility marking systems, helping crews instantly recognize what each marking represents.
Outdoor conditions can quickly degrade low quality tape. Presco flagging tape is designed to resist fading and deterioration caused by sunlight, rain, and wind. This durability allows markings to remain effective for extended periods, even on longer projects.

Presco flagging tape is used across a wide range of industries where temporary marking is essential.
Utility Locating and Excavation
Utility crews use flagging tape to identify buried lines and infrastructure before digging begins. Clear markings reduce the risk of damage and improve coordination.
Construction and Site Safety
Contractors rely on flagging tape to mark hazards, access points, and restricted areas. Bright tape helps prevent accidents by clearly defining safe zones.
Surveying and Layout
Surveyors use flagging tape to mark reference points, boundaries, and layout areas. The tape provides a visible guide that remains effective throughout the survey process.
Landscaping and Tree Marking
Landscapers use flagging tape to identify trees, irrigation lines, or planting areas. The flexibility of the tape makes it ideal for temporary and reusable markings.
Clear marking plays an important role in job site safety and regulatory compliance. Flagging tape supports hazard identification and utility marking systems that help crews avoid dangerous mistakes.
Color coding is especially important for underground utilities. Industry standards help ensure that workers can quickly recognize what lies beneath the surface.
